Welcome to Sam's Greek Cafe

At Sam's Greek Cafe, located in Clarksville, TN, customers rave about the authentic Mediterranean flavors and friendly service. The restaurant offers a variety of vegetarian options, including the highly recommended falafels. Customers praise the delicious lamb gyros, stuffed grape leaves, and Chicago hot dog. The owners are known for their gluten-free options and willingness to share cooking tips. While some patrons prefer other locations, the overall consensus is that Sam's Greek Cafe is a hidden gem worth visiting for a taste of homemade Mediterranean cuisine with a welcoming ambiance.

Location

Welcome to Sam's Greek Cafe, a hidden gem located at 1761 Tiny Town Rd in Clarksville, TN. This unclaimed culinary treasure offers a wide range of amenities to enhance your dining experience, including delivery, takeout, reservations, outdoor seating, and catering services.

Upon stepping foot inside Sam's Greek Cafe, you'll be greeted with a cozy and casual atmosphere that is perfect for groups, families, and even a quiet solo meal. The menu boasts many vegetarian options, ensuring there's something for everyone to enjoy.
